Why We Use Polyaspartic Coatings
Not all garage floor coatings perform equally in Florida's climate. Heat, UV exposure, and humidity put demands on a floor coating that not every product handles well. We use polyaspartic coatings because their performance characteristics suit those conditions.
Polyaspartic coatings offer strong UV stability — they resist yellowing and color shift from sun exposure in ways that matter in a Florida garage environment. They cure faster than many alternatives, reducing the time before the floor is back in use. And they hold up to temperature fluctuations and surface expansion without the brittleness that can develop in coatings less suited to heat.

Surface Preparation for Garage Floor Coatings
A coating's performance begins with the surface it's applied to. Concrete floors require cleaning, evaluation, and appropriate preparation before any coating is applied — removing contaminants, addressing surface damage, and creating a profile that supports adhesion.
We assess the concrete surface before beginning work. The preparation required depends on the floor's current condition — its age, surface texture, prior treatments, and whether any damage or contamination is present. We don't skip those steps to move faster.

Common Questions About Garage Floor Coatings in Jacksonville
What is a polyaspartic garage floor coating?
Polyaspartic is a category of floor coating applied to concrete surfaces. It cures quickly, offers strong UV and heat resistance, and produces a durable, finished appearance. We use polyaspartic coatings for garage floors because their performance characteristics suit Florida's climate and the demands of a residential or commercial garage environment.
How does polyaspartic perform in Florida's heat and humidity?
Polyaspartic coatings are selected in part for their performance under UV exposure and temperature variation — conditions Jacksonville garages experience regularly. They resist yellowing and hold up to the surface expansion and contraction that heat cycles can cause in a Florida environment.
